  • Dr. Luis Cuervo, Medical Oncologist at Abben Cancer Center, to Launch Outreach Clinic at Pocahontas Community Hospital

    posted on Wednesday, January 15, 2025 Abben Cancer Center of Spencer Hospital is proud to announce the expansion of its oncology services with the introduction of an outreach clinic at Pocahontas Community Hospital. Beginning in late February, Dr. Luis Cuervo, a highly respected medical oncologist from Abben Cancer Center, will see patients in Pocahontas twice a month, offering consultations, follow-up appointments, and select non-chemotherapy treatments.

  • Spencer Hospital Welcomes Medical Oncologist Through Innovative Partnership with University of Iowa Hospitals

    posted on Thursday, August 22, 2024 Abben Cancer Center welcomes Dr. Luis Cuervo, a distinguished medical oncologist, as part of a collaboration with the University of Iowa Holden Comprehensive Cancer Center. Dr. Cuervo will provide full-time medical oncology services at Abben Cancer Center and serve as an associate professor at the University of Iowa. This collaboration aims to bring advanced practice standards and exceptional oncology care to our region.
